A total of nine people remain missing after the collapse of a building in the center of Marseille last night due to an explosion, as reported by the French Prosecutor’s Office.

The prosecutor has indicated that for the moment the causes of the explosion that caused the collapse are unknown. “The expert has not yet been able to access the place due to the risk it entails, since the situation has not yet stabilized. There are still very hot areas,” she explained. A neighbor in the area has reported that he could hear “a big explosion” and that when he approached the area he could see “a lot of dust” and “smell” of gas.

The fire has not yet been extinguishedwhich makes it difficult to search for possible survivors, the French Interior Minister, Gérald Darmanin, had previously reported, displaced to the scene of the incident.

Meanwhile, the authorities have evacuated a total of 32 buildings, and 163 have been the people who have received health care.
